Rudolf Baumgartner

Rudolf Baumgartner

Swiss Conductor and Violinist

Rudolf Baumgartner was a Swiss violinist and conductor, renowned for his contributions to classical music, particularly in the 20th century. Born on August 14, 1917, in Zürich, he went on to study violin with the esteemed pedagogue Carl Flesch and later with Stefi Geyer. Baumgartner co-founded the Lucerne Festival Strings (Festival Strings Lucerne) in 1956 with Wolfgang Schneiderhan, which became one of the most respected chamber orchestras in the world. Under his leadership, the ensemble gained international acclaim for their performances and recordings of Baroque and classical repertoire.
